Turkey Point is a compact rural community in Norfolk, Ontario, Canada. It is classified as a town. Turkey Point is located at 42.6937°N, 80.3279°W. It observes Eastern Time (UTC−5 / −4). Postal code area: N3Y.
Turkey Point asserts itself as a modest promontory reaching into the vast, restless expanse of Lake Erie. It lies 16.5 km south of Simcoe, ON (from Simcoe, ON: bearing 184°T), and is situated 13.9 km south-south-east of Norfolk County.
